    Mothers day hatch under my broody :)

    Most of them hatched mothers day, and a few monday. Out of a dozen eggs one was tossed at day 10 due to no development, and the hen tossed 2 around hatch time (they looked full term and healthy, but I figure a broody knows better than I do). All in all, we have 9 fuzzy healthy chicks, and...
